Hi, that worked for localhost. For remote connections I added: host all all ::ffff:192.168.41.0/120 trust and it worked also (I guessed it - I don't know much about IPv6). Is there any chance to get it work like 7.3? It is no nice experience for new users. Tommi Mäkitalo Am Montag, 1. September 2003 23:24 schrieb Tom Lane: > Tommi Mäkitalo <t.maekitalo@epgmbh.de> writes: > > It's a SuSE Linux 8.2-box with the original 2.4.20-kernel. > > I get the same error when setting PGHOST to localhost, the real hostname > > or the IP-adress of the box. It has nothing to do with the resolver I > > think. > > Hm. I assume things will work after you uncomment the commented-out > IPv6 entries at the bottom of pg_hba.conf. > > regards, tom lane
